Synodus randalli is a species of lizardfish that lives mainly in the Western Indian Ocean and the Red Sea.[1]

Information

Synodus randalli can be found in a marine environment within a benthopelagic range. This species is native to a tropical climate. Synodus randalli have an average length of 11.3 centimeters or 4.4 inches as an unsexed male.[2] They live in salt water systems.[3]
